How much do java programming j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for java programming in Kentucky is $49.24,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42.60 and $55.10 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Java programming job?

A Java Programming job involves designing, developing, and maintaining applications using the Java programming language. Java developers work on a variety of projects, including web applications, mobile apps, enterprise software, and cloud-based solutions. Responsibilities often include writing code, debugging, testing, and collaborating with teams to ensure software efficiency and scalability. Java is widely used due to its platform independence, making it a valuable skill in industries like finance, healthcare, and technology.

What does a typical workday look like for a Java programmer?

A typical workday for a Java Programmer involves writing, testing, and debugging code for various applications or backend systems, often as part of a broader development team. You may participate in daily stand-up meetings, collaborate with project managers or QA engineers, and review code with peers to ensure best practices are followed. Beyond coding, you might also contribute to design discussions, refine user stories, and handle tasks related to integrating APIs or optimizing system performance. This role balances independent programming tasks with frequent interaction and coordination across technical and sometimes client-facing te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Java programming position, and why are they important?

To thrive in Java Programming, you need a strong command of object-oriented programming, problem-solving abilities, and typically a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with development tools such as Eclipse or IntelliJ IDEA, version control systems like Git, and relevant Java certifications (e.g., Oracle Certified Professional) is highly valued. Strong teamwork, effective communication, and adaptability help Java programmers excel in collaborative and fast-paced environments. These skills ensure the delivery of robust, maintainable code and support ongoing success in evolving tech landscapes.

Are Java programmers still in demand?

Java programmers remain in high demand due to the language's widespread use in enterprise applications, Android development, and backend systems. Skills in Java, along with knowledge of frameworks like Spring and experience with cloud environments, enhance job prospects in this field.

Is Java programming still in demand?

Java programming remains in high demand across various industries such as finance, enterprise software, and Android app development. Java developers with knowledge of frameworks like Spring and experience with cloud environments are particularly sought after, and the language continues to be a core skill for many software development roles.

What jobs can you get with Java programming?

Java programming skills can lead to roles such as Java developer, software engineer, backend developer, Android app developer, and systems analyst. These positions typically require knowledge of Java frameworks, object-oriented programming, and development tools like IDEs and version control systems.

Which pays more, C++ or Java?

For Java programming jobs, salaries are generally comparable to C++ roles, but C++ developers often earn slightly higher due to the complexity of systems programming and performance-critical applications. Both skills are in demand, and compensation depends on experience, industry, and location. Certifications and proficiency in related tools can also influence pay levels.

Sr. Full Stack Java Developer

Location:
Expected to be local or willing to relocate to Pittsburgh only.

Contract:
W2 only, 6-12 month contract with potential for extension or conversion to full time with either the client or CEI.

Pay:
$60/hour + optional medical, dental, vision, 401(k) match

Overview

Perform design tasks and develop components of application and technical architecture. Develops software components and hardware for new and emerging technology projects; aligns these with business strategies and objectives. Oversee and provide consultation on common issues and best practices to the development team. May assist with selecting appropriate platforms, integrates and configures solutions. Execute tests for the application or technical architecture components, work with other programmers, designers, and architects to meet application requirements and performance goals, participate in code reviews, inform the technical architect and project manager of any issues that may affect any other areas of the project, fix any defects and performance problems discovered in testing, document the application to facilitate maintenance. Provides a systematic analysis on client requirements within the traceability framework and resolves any functional problems encountered. Ensures quality of project deliverables while maintaining compliance with relevant standards and processes.

Key Responsibilities
  • Perform design tasks and develop components of application and technical architecture
  • Develops software components and hardware for new and emerging technology projects; aligns these with business strategies and objectives
  • Oversee and provide consultation on common issues and best practices to the development team
  • May assist with selecting appropriate platforms, integrates and configures solutions
  • Execute tests for the application or technical architecture components, work with other programmers, designers, and architects to meet application requirements and performance goals
  • Participate in code reviews, inform the technical architect and project manager of any issues that may affect any other areas of the project
  • Fix any defects and performance problems discovered in testing, document the application to facilitate maintenance
  • Provide a systematic analysis on client requirements within the traceability framework and resolve any functional problems encountered
  • Ensure quality of project deliverables while maintaining compliance with relevant standards and processes
Required Skills
  • 10+ years of hands-on full stack development experience
  • Strong proficiency in Java (Java 8+)
  • Hands-on experience with Angular (TypeScript, HTML, CSS)
  • Solid understanding of Object Oriented Programming (OOP), Design patterns (Factory, Singleton, DAO, etc.), & Exception handling, multithreading, and collections
  • Experience with Microservices architecture is strongly preferred
  • Experience building scalable, maintainable backend services
  • Strong experience designing and developing RESTful APIs
  • Hands-on with Spring Boot / Spring MVC API design best practices: HTTP methods, status codes, Request/response validation, Versioning strategies
  • Familiarity with API documentation tools (Swagger / OpenAPI)
  • API testing using tools such as Postman, REST Assured, or similar
  • Spring Framework (Core, Boot, MVC)
  • ORM frameworks such as Hibernate / JPA
  • Strong hands-on experience with SQL
  • Experience with relational databases such as Oracle or Teradata
  • DevOps experience with Maven / Gradle
  • Version control using Git/bitbucket
  • CI/CD exposure (Jenkins, GitHub Actions, Azure DevOps, udeploy etc.)
  • Basic knowledge of Linux/Unix environments
  • Experience deploying applications on application servers (Tomcat, WebLogic, etc.) & containers (Docker – preferred)
  • Ability to write and optimize complex joins, subqueries, stored procedures (nice to have)
  • Dependency Injection and Aspect Oriented Programming (AOP)
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Self-starter, independent worker able to see through to completion
